The court she has filled this case in requires there to be at least 75k worth of damages to proceed.

I’ve not read the filling myself (might read it later on, but also I might not), but the article says they are looking for a figure in excess of 75k, they can amend their filing later to increase their demand, or (if they win) leave the final figure to the decision of the jury.

(I means the jury will have a say in the figure either way, but stating what you want in the filing telegraphs to the jury what you actually want.)

All this is to say the figure in this filing isn’t the figure she will probably end up asking for.

(However, all civil courts can award you is money. So when all the person wants is to have their case heard. Have their side heard, and it’s not about the money, they will often ask for the minimum.)
